History

The district was established in 1972 by merging the former districts of Neustadt an der Waldnaab, Eschenbach and Vohenstrauß.

Coat of arms

The coat of arms displays: * the heraldic lion of the Palatinate * three stars from the arms of the county of Störnstein * blue and white bars from the arms of the county of Leuchtenberg
